Highlights
- Household income in Dublin, is 192% more than it is in McDonald and is 53% above the National Average.
- McDonald unemployment rate is 7.9%.
- Dublin unemployment rate is 5.2%.

Economy
 McDonald, PADublin, OHUnited States
 Unemployment Rate7.9%5.2%6.0%
 Recent Job Growth0.3%0.9%1.6%
 Future Job Growth24.4%34.5%33.5%
 Sales Taxes6.0%7.5%6.2%
 Income Taxes4.1%5.5%4.6%
 Income per Cap.$27,542$65,983$37,638
 Household Income$49,976$145,828$69,021
 Family Median Income$61,141$161,933$85,028
